IMDb TV is inviting Luke Bryan fans to crash his party this summer. Amazon’s streamer has set an August 6 premiere for Luke Bryan: My Dirt Road Diary, a five-part docuseries about the country star and American Idol judge.
Gary Cole, David Harbour, Patti Harrison, Laurie Metcalf, Matt Rogers, Wanda Sykes and creator/executive producer Gabe Liedman will join Sean Hayes in the voice cast of Q-Force, Netflix’s gay spy animated comedy from Hayes and Todd Milliner’s Hazy Mills, Mike Schur’s Fremulon, Brooklyn Nine-Nine’s Liedman and Universal TV.

Bandai Namco has cancelled Tekken x Street Fighter, 11 years after it was first announced.Tekken creator Katsuhiro Harada and Tekken 7 director Kouhei Ikeda have confirmed that the highly-anticipated Tekken and Street Fighter crossover has been canned.“We were working really hard on that, we really were,” they said during the most recent episode of Harada’s Bar (via TheGamer).

The Scott Morrison government is on track to bring back its controversial Religious Discrimination Bill before the Parliament by December 2021. Attorney General Michaelia Cash, who voted this week to delay medical treatment for trans children, has indicated that a fresh draft of the Bill will be placed before the Parliament by the end of the year.

Forza Horizon 5 has received an extensive reveal during the Xbox and Bethesda games showcase.The upcoming racing game from Playground Games also has a confirmed release date of November 9, 2021.Forza Horizon 5 will take place in Mexico and explores a variety of environments ranging from rainforests to vibrant cities, and a dormant volcano .The city of Guanajuato will feature heavily in the game.

Showtime has acquired The One and Only Dick Gregory, a feature-length documentary about the comedian and activist who specialized in cultural disruption. The pic about the late icon will air, appropriately, on the Fourth of July — following its June 19 world premiere at the Tribeca Film Festival.
Paramount+ announced on Monday that it will significantly expand its content offering to more than 2,500 titles by the end of summer, starting with the exclusive premiere of the sci-fi action film Infinite, which will make its debut June 10. It stars Mark Wahlberg and Chiwetel Ejiofor and is directed by Antoine Fuqua.

Peacock has acquired Civil War (Or, Who Do We Think We Are), a documentary from director Rachel Boynton whose EPs include Brad Pitt and Henry Louis Gates Jr. The film will bow June 17 on NBCUniversal’s streamer, then premiere on MSNBC in October.
